Kūh-e Shāhīn Kamar
Kūh-e Shāhīn Kamar is a mountain in Mazandaran, Iran and has an elevation of 1,711 metres. Kūh-e Shāhīn Kamar is situated nearby to the village Shiler, as well as near the locality Sabeq.Places in the Area

Shiler
Village
Shiler is a village in Ashrestaq Rural District, Yaneh Sar District, Behshahr County, Mazandaran Province, Iran. At the 2016 census, its population was 187, in 61 families.
Bisheh Boneh
Village
Bisheh Boneh is a village in Ashrestaq Rural District of Yaneh Sar District in Behshahr County, Mazandaran province, Iran, serving as capital of both the district and the rural district.
Gornam
Village
Gornam is a village in Ashrestaq Rural District of Yaneh Sar District in Behshahr County, Mazandaran province, Iran. Gornam is situated 2½ km northwest of Kūh-e Shāhīn Kamar.
